LINUX.ORG.RU

Вышел libvpx 1.0.0 «Duclair»

 , ,


0

0

Duclair, четвёртый именованный релиз VP8 Codec SDK (libvpx), доступен для загрузки.

Сам формат VP8 остался прежним, изменения коснулись только SDK. Duclair на бинарном уровне не совместим с предыдущими версиями libvpx, поэтому была увеличена старшая версия до 1. Уже готовые приложения необходимо будет пересобрать, при этом необходимости вносить изменения в код нет, так как API остался неизменным.

В этой версии было исправлено падение, обнаруженное в предыдущей версии Cayuga (0.9.7), поэтому всем пользователям рекомендуется обновиться.

Новые возможности:

  • Существенные изменения кодировщика, направленные на оптимизацию для живого-вещания и видеоконференций.
    • Добавлена поддержка «temporal scalability» — метода кодирования, при котором поток разбивается на несколько подпотоков, каждый со своей частотой кадров. Это позволяет, к примеру, при недостаточной пропускной способности канала, переключиться на канал с более низкой частотой кадров, вместо заметного для глаза пропуска кадров.
    • Мультикадровая постобработка позволяет сделать визуальное качество более однородным при наличии кадров, сильно отличающихся по качеству от соседних.
    • Режим кодирования «multiple-resolution» включает одновременное кодирование одного и того же контента в разных разрешениях, что позволяет увеличить скорость процесса по сравнению с раздельной обработкой.
  • Улучшения производительности. При подготовке релиза силы были сфокусированы на оптимизации кодера и декодера в режимах реального времени.
    • На процессорах архитектуры x86 скорость декодирования увеличена на 10,5%.
    • Увеличена производительность для различных скоростных режимов кодера: режимы 1-3 — 1,5-4%, режимы 4-8 — <1%, режимы 9-16 — 1,5-10,5%.

Подробное описание изменений


Загрузить

>>> Подробности

★★★★★

Проверено: JB ()
Последнее исправление: Dendy (всего исправлений: 5)
Ответ на: комментарий от timur_dav

Странно, на моём Athlon II X2 WebM быстрее софтверного рендеринга Flash. Это при том, что flash использует быстрый h264 а не более медленный WebM. А вообще, у меня декодируется нормально даже WebM в HD. А вот атом - жуткое тормозное УГ. Я имел с ним дело, два дня. И понял, что таким я пользоваться просто не в силах. На нем даже Windows XP, что был предустановлен на заводе ASUS тормозит неимоверно, как таким можно пользоваться? Мне моего камня не всегда хватает, хоть обычно он не загружен даже на половину... А Atom - ему место только в маленьких домашних торрентокачалках и файлопомойках.

lucentcode ★★★★★
()
Ответ на: комментарий от lucentcode

Странно, на моём Athlon II X2 WebM быстрее софтверного рендеринга Flash...

Возможно оно и так, но на интеле меня удручает. Кроме Е350 ничего нет от AMD, не думаю, что он сильно быстрее Atom в этом деле :) А вот с Nvidia с некоторыми версиями везло и можно было поиметь профит от VDPAU.

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от lucentcode

Надо проверить будет как-то и сподобиться запустить его на OS X. Вообще, по опыту кач-во изображения в конференциях больше зависит от камеры и освещения. Шумящая картинка, снятая в потёмках, жмётся хуже. А с другой стороны, при ярком освещении камера бампает частоту кадров на максимум и пропорционально скачет назрузка на камень и битрейт. Ещё в большинстве UVC камер зачем-то включено аппаратное усиление контраста, стоит отключить и можно получить меньший битрейт.

Вывод: результат не всегда столь очевиден.

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от timur_dav

Браузера. В chromium 18 с WebM 1080p всё отлично, и нигде ничего не перекрывает. Правда, я использую новый интерфейс YouTUBE, а не классический.

lucentcode ★★★★★
()
Ответ на: комментарий от timur_dav

С этим я согласен. Многое зависит не от кодека, а от настроек камеры и освещённости. Как только освещённость приглушаю, сразу видео начинает замедляться. Кстати, видео использую не только в skype, но и в чате Google Plus. Интересно какой там кодек.

lucentcode ★★★★★
()
Ответ на: комментарий от lucentcode

Интересно какой там кодек.

H.264 вестимо. Empathy утверждает об этом.

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от lucentcode

VAAPI уже поддерживается Flash? Для VDPAU никто не отменял прокладку для получения интерфейса VAAPI :) Нвидиа вперде.

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от lucentcode

Как только освещённость приглушаю, сразу видео начинает замедляться.

Это логика работы любой камеры, она снижает частоту кадров, сенсору же нужно накопить минимальный заряд и на это тратится больше времени. А иначе шум, шум, шум...

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от lucentcode

А Atom - ему место только в маленьких домашних торрентокачалках и файлопомойках.

для этого есть arm. А атому место на помойке.

AVL2 ★★★★★
()
Ответ на: комментарий от lucentcode

А вот атом - жуткое тормозное УГ. Я имел с ним дело, два дня. И понял, что таким я пользоваться просто не в силах. На нем даже Windows XP, что был предустановлен на заводе ASUS тормозит неимоверно, как таким можно пользоваться?

Я вот своим уже третий (!!) год как пользуюсь и не нарадуюсь. Что я на нём только не делал! И лабы, и курсовые, и собственные велосипедики, и по работе тяжелые проекты собираю, и ведь хватает. Видосы можно с vdpau в чодких разрешениях смотреть. Емакс не тормозит, оконный менеджер не тормозит, браузер не тормозит.

А ведь тот же атом. Может тебе просто с железом не повезло, или с руками?

anonymous
()
Ответ на: комментарий от timur_dav

Я даже без понятия. Всё равно проигрывание 1080p особо проц не нагружает. Было бы иначе, может заинтересовался бы.

lucentcode ★★★★★
()
Ответ на: комментарий от timur_dav

chromium не поддерживает H264.Нужен специальный плагин, разрабатываемый непонятно кем. Толку от него. chrome 16 - вчерашний день, 18 мне больше по душе. Но он нестабильный:) Хотя работает у меня стабильно, не разу не крашился. Да, chrome 18 тоже без h264 вроде. Обновляетйсь:)

lucentcode ★★★★★
()
Ответ на: комментарий от AVL2

Вот, это верное замечание. Я именно ARM и хочу для домашнего сервачка прикупить, но в Молдове не продают такое железо.

lucentcode ★★★★★
()
Ответ на: комментарий от anonymous

Ага, так у вас на атоме linux? С легковесной WM? А KDE поставить не пробовали? Вот тогда и начнётся веселье. Добавим к этому Eclipse/Netbeans и система вообще повесится:)

lucentcode ★★★★★
()
Ответ на: комментарий от anonymous

mips активно используют военные. У вас в РФ даже лицензированный производитель есть, вроде даже не один. Так-что MIPS рулит. Говорят он из всех микропроцессоров наиболее устойчив к экстремальным условиям. Но на гражданке его оценили по достоинству только производители рутеров, принтеров и прочей потребительской электроники(телевизоры, приставки).

lucentcode ★★★★★
()
Ответ на: комментарий от timur_dav

Мы разве не о general purpose материнских платах говорим? Телефонов вон на арме тоже много, но что толку?

прошу прощения, не понял сути вопроса. При чем тут телефоны? Ты же просил железку с 4 портами сата. Ну вот, тут тебе готовая железка и портов САТА шесть. С готовыми местами под 4 винчестера. Ставь свою ось и пользуй на здоровье или используй предустановленный линукс со своим репом пакетиков.

Да, на арме делают готовые решения, а не конструктор лего, как в x86. Но этих решений уже на любое применение понаделали, так что не вижу в этом проблемы. Главное, чтобы в магазах оно было и федора чтобы под арм догнала сборку под x86.

AVL2 ★★★★★
()
Ответ на: комментарий от lucentcode

mips активно используют военные.

помнится на нем был сделан линуксовый наладонник agenda vr3. Неплохо работал.

AVL2 ★★★★★
()
Ответ на: комментарий от lucentcode

Я даже без понятия. Всё равно проигрывание 1080p особо проц не нагружает. Было бы иначе, может заинтересовался бы.

я тут со стереофильмами так бы не сказал. Пришлось включить два ядра, что играть без задержек.

AVL2 ★★★★★
()
Ответ на: комментарий от lucentcode

Говорят он из всех микропроцессоров наиболее устойчив к экстремальным условиям.

Зависит же от исполнения. Да, на Марсы NASA предпочитает PowerPC запускать, наверное не в курсе :)

timur_dav ☆☆☆☆☆
()
Ответ на: комментарий от AVL2

Стереофильмы - это 3D? Я объёмное видео не воспринимаю, так как у меня зрение нестандартное. Один глаз видит немного хуже нормы(-0.8), второй -1.8 + астигматизм 0.5. В результате там где другим объём, мне облом:)

lucentcode ★★★★★
()

Надеюсь, теперь и 1080p-файлы на YouTube будут перекодированы. А то надоело скачивать только в 720p файлы с расширением webm, когда в h264 доступен 1080p.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от timur_dav

Про PowerPC слышал, тоже замечательная архитектура. А x86 и прочее попсовое железо им в подмётки не годится. Оно не может быть качественным по определению, слишком сложная архитектура.

lucentcode ★★★★★
()
Ответ на: комментарий от ZenitharChampion

Часть файлов точно перекодировали. Потому что я уже смотрел ролики в данном качестве.

lucentcode ★★★★★
()
Ответ на: комментарий от lucentcode

таки стереоочки поверх своих одевают.

AVL2 ★★★★★
()
Ответ на: комментарий от lucentcode

 — Бернсторф-это голова! — отвечал спрошенный жилет таким тоном, будто убедился в том на основе долголетнего знакомства с графом. — А вы читали, какую речь произнес Сноуден на собрании избирателей в Бирмингаме, этой цитадели консерваторов?

 — Ну, о чем говорить... Сноуден-это голОва! Слушайте, Валиадис, — обращался он к третьему старику в панаме. - Что вы скажете насчет Сноудена?

 — Я скажу вам откровенно, - отвечала панама, - Сноудену пальца в рот не клади. Я лично свой палец не положил бы.

И, нимало не смущаясь тем, что Сноуден ни за что на свете не позволил бы Валиадису лезть пальцем в свой рот, старик продолжал:

 — Но что бы вы ни говорили, я вам скажу откровенно-Чемберлен все-таки тоже голова.

AVL2 ★★★★★
()
Ответ на: комментарий от RussianNeuroMancer

>> Лично я на трубе отключил html5 только потому, что они не все ролики через него показывают.

Теперь все. Да, 100%.

Поддерживаю - даже на страницах каналов пользователей заиграло видео, которое раньше не работало так как с HTML5 не показывалась реклама. А показывается ли она теперь - не знаю.

ZenitharChampion ★★★★★
()

Не понял :

Это позволяет, к примеру, при недостаточной пропускной
способности канала, переключиться на канал с более низкой
частотой кадров, вместо заметного для глаза пропуска кадров.

и

сделать визуальное качество более однородным при наличии кадров,
сильно отличающихся по качеству от соседних.

За место первого не судьба, что ли второе заюзать ?

mx__ ★★★★★
()
Ответ на: комментарий от timur_dav

Так я ни один релиз между 9 и 12 не проверял. Может фича появилась гораздо раньше, чем в 12.

RussianNeuroMancer ★★★★★
()

В то время, как последние обновление h264 увеличивает степени сжатия на 10-30% с тем же качеством, они продолжают насиловать труп

namezys ★★★★
()
Ответ на: комментарий от RussianNeuroMancer

Firefox 12 - разворачивает.

Даже не знаю, вот как на такое реагировать. Последняя млять федора 16, меньше года, файрфокс 9, а тут пишут, что файрфокс 100500 разворачивает. Бесит...

AVL2 ★★★★★
()
Ответ на: комментарий от namezys

В то время, как последние обновление h264 увеличивает степени сжатия на 10-30% с тем же качеством, они продолжают насиловать труп

h264 и есть труп из-за копирастов, а WebM живее всех живых. К слову в ffmpeg свой декодер WebM и он гораздо быстрее libvpx.

stalkerg ★★★★★
()
Ответ на: комментарий от namezys

платить деньги. Не так они и много просят, чаще всего.

Свободное ПО должно оставаться свободным. Разве не так?

AVL2 ★★★★★
()
Ответ на: комментарий от namezys

А с какого … я должен платить за то, что кто-то решил закодировать видео именно в таком формате, а я просто хочу это видео просмотреть? Вот если бы брали только с тех, кто принимает решение использовать этот кодек, то тогда бы ещё можно было согласиться, но тогда бы эта модель сама сдохла при наличии альтернативы. А сейчас, когда часть денег (может даже бо́льшую) платит зритель, который не может повлиять на выбор кодека, производители контента в этом не заинтересованы. Они платят не очень много, а основную часть отчислений платит тот, кого просто третье лицо поставило перед выбором: «плати нам, либо мы посадим тебя в информационный вакуум».

Ttt ☆☆☆☆☆
()
Ответ на: комментарий от Ttt

Когда это h264 стал платный? Это раз

Два - у пользователя всегда есть возможность найти другого поставщика контента, которые договорился с правообладателем.

namezys ★★★★
()
Ответ на: комментарий от namezys

Когда это h264 стал платный? Это раз

А когда он был бесплатным?

Два - у пользователя всегда есть возможность найти другого поставщика контента, которые договорился с правообладателем.

Насколько я знаю, пользователь должен платить за право декодирования вне зависимости от того, сколько заплатил поставщик.

Ttt ☆☆☆☆☆
()
Ответ на: комментарий от namezys

Да эта версия только что вышла, а вы, банальные рабы, сразу её обсираете, когда ещё ни одного теста не было.

Ttt ☆☆☆☆☆
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.